Technology - Robotic Arm


With more and more soldiers going off fighting in Iraq and other places the risk of them getting injured or even killed is forever getting higher and higher. Therefore, the need for prosthetic limbs is becoming more in demand the peice of technology in the photo above is used on a soldier that hasn't lost him arm but was paralysed and it uses hydraulics to sensors the move and function his arm so he can at least do the basics things to get around. While this works its only a concept at the minute but shows promise by winning the Dyson Award for the design of the product if this comes in manufacture it will change many life's effected by war injuries and change how people see and use technology.
